Erro no projecto Zipper7

Post Reply
jufer
Posts: 50
Joined: Wed Nov 16, 2005 7:10 pm
Location: Portugal

Erro no projecto Zipper7

Post by jufer »

Incorporei o projecto ZIPPER7 no meu projecto e compilou muito bem, sem nenhum erro. Quando executo ao fechar dá um erro que não consigo identificar. Aparece uma tela de erros dizendo o seguinte:
"O 12 FiveWin Controls encontrou um problema e vai ser encerrado. Lamentamos qualquer inconveniente que isto lhe possa causar"

Alguém me pode ajudar??

Muito obrigado

Júlio Fernandes
jufer
Posts: 50
Joined: Wed Nov 16, 2005 7:10 pm
Location: Portugal

Re: Erro no projecto Zipper7

Post by jufer »

jufer wrote:Incorporei o projecto ZIPPER7 no meu projecto e compilou muito bem, sem nenhum erro. Quando executo ao fechar dá um erro que não consigo identificar. Aparece uma tela de erros dizendo o seguinte:
"O 12 FiveWin Controls encontrou um problema e vai ser encerrado. Lamentamos qualquer inconveniente que isto lhe possa causar"

Alguém me pode ajudar??

Muito obrigado

Júlio Fernandes
Já isolei o erro e vou ver se consigo explicar para que me possam ajudar a ultrapassar.

O erro dá-se nesta função:

HB_ZIPFILE(cPathPak+NombreDelZip, acFilesPak, 9,,lSobrescribe,,.F.,.F.,)

Para compactar se eu seleccionar o primeiro ou todos os ficheiros de uma pasta o erro surge, no entanto se eu escolher o ficheiro só o ficheiro que está em último lugar a função executa na perfeição.

Penso que a função não consegue adicionar os ficheiros. Como iniciante não sei como fazer para ultrapassar o erro.

Agradeço antecipadamente.

Jufer
User avatar
vilian
Posts: 795
Joined: Wed Nov 09, 2005 2:17 am
Location: Brazil
Contact:

Re: Erro no projecto Zipper7

Post by vilian »

Olá Jufer,

Eu faço assim:

Code: Select all

aFiles := Directory( ("*.DBF" ) )
FOR n = 1 TO Len(aFiles)
       Hb_ZipFile( "copia.zip",aFiles[n,1],,,.f.,,.f.,.f. )
NEXT
 
Sds,
Vilian F. Arraes
vilian@vfatec.com.br
Belém-Pa-Brazil
jufer
Posts: 50
Joined: Wed Nov 16, 2005 7:10 pm
Location: Portugal

Re: Erro no projecto Zipper7

Post by jufer »

Caro Vilian,

Muito obrigado pela sua ajuda. Realmente o função funciona bem quando se quer compactar todos os ficheiros com determinada terminação, por ex *.DBF, *.EXE, etc. Mas não posso seleccionar os ficheiros que pretendo copiar.

De qualquer modo agradeço. Se vc me permitir posso mandar os ficheiros fonte para vc estudar melhor.

Um abraço

Júlio Fernandes
Post Reply